The development of the constitution of Zimbabwe reflects many aspects of the political turmoil currently troubling the country. The constitution as an institution can therefore be analyzed in a perspective of historical institutionalism where the theory of path dependency provides an understanding of the choices made by different political actors throughout Zimbabwe’s independent history. Scientific assessments, such as those by the Intergovernmental Panel on Climate Change (IPCC), inform policymakers and the public about the state of scientific evidence and related uncertainties. Battery thermal management (BTM) plays a significant role in the safety and reliability of autonomous underwater vehicles (AUV) at higher speeds. In this study, a nanoparticle/phase change material (nano-PCM) composite is proposed for the BTM of an AUV. The arrangement of plant species within a landscape influences pollination via changes in pollinator movement trajectories and plant–pollinator encounter rates. Yet the combined effects of landscape composition and pollinator traits (especially specialisation) on pollination success remain hard to quantify empirically. Background & aims: Tissue transglutaminase autoantibodies (tTGA) are used as diagnostic markers of celiac disease. Different methods have been developed for the detection of tTGA of which enzyme-linked immunosorbent assays (ELISA), radiobinding assays (RBA) and electrochemiluminescence (ECL) assays are the most commonly used. The frequency dependence of the longitudinal relaxation rate, known as the magnetic relaxation dispersion (MRD), can provide a frequency-resolved characterization of molecular motions in complex biological and colloidal systems on time scales ranging from 1 ns to 100 μs. Purpose: Direct laryngoscopy (DL) is the standard technique for endotracheal intubation. Video-assisted laryngoscopy (VL) has emerged as an alternative, particularly for difficult airway management. Nevertheless, DL and VL have not been systematically compared for simulation-based endotracheal intubation by inexperienced operators. AbstractThe uptake of different nitrogen forms by understory species was studied in field and laboratory. Species of the understory in deciduous forests have previously been thought to take up and assimilate only inorganic nitrogen sources. Until now inscriptions have confirmed that the quarries of Gebel el Silsila East were in use until the time of Emperor Tiberius, but recent findings indicate that the quarrying process continued for at least another two generations. Polymeric anion-exchange membranes (AEMs) are critical components for alkaline membrane fuel cells (AMFCs) which offer several attractive advantages including the use of platinum-free catalysts and a wide choice of fuel.
